Quels sont les modes de jeu les plus populaires dans Fortnite ?

4 Answers2026-06-09 08:09:41
Fortnite's ever-evolving gameplay keeps me hooked, and the variety of modes is insane! The Battle Royale mode is obviously the king—100 players dropping onto the island, scrambling for loot, and fighting to be the last one standing. It’s pure adrenaline, especially with the constant map changes and live events. But Creative Mode is where I lose hours—building my own mini-games or exploring community-made maps feels like stepping into a sandbox of endless possibilities. Then there’s Zero Build, which strips away the construction aspect and focuses purely on gunplay, perfect for when I want a more straightforward shooter experience. Save the World doesn’get as much love as it should—it’s this co-op PvE campaign with tower defense elements and quirky humor. It’s a different vibe, slower-paced but rewarding. And let’s not forget limited-time modes like Team Rumble or Impostors, which shake up the formula with chaotic twists. Honestly, Fortnite’s strength is how it caters to so many playstyles—whether I’m in the mood for competitive sweatfests or just goofing around with friends.

Quels sont les tips pour débuter dans un FPS def jeu ?

4 Answers2026-06-25 18:35:21
Starting out in a competitive FPS can feel overwhelming, but breaking it down helps. First, focus on movement—strafe, crouch, and jump unpredictably to avoid being an easy target. Games like 'Valorant' or 'Counter-Strike 2' punish static players hard. Then, dial in your sensitivity; too high and you overshoot, too low and you can’t react. Spend time in training modes or aim labs to find your sweet spot. Map knowledge is another game-changer. Learn common angles, flank routes, and where enemies tend to camp. Watching pro players on Twitch can reveal tricks you’d never think of, like pre-fire spots or grenade lineups. Also, sound cues are huge—footsteps, reloads, and ability sounds give away positions. Turn down music and crank up effects volume. Lastly, don’t tilt. Even pros whiff shots; staying calm lets you adapt mid-round.
